Output f374a13308199879240b1052c536e6bfa746de34d2c55d0a8dd06064067f00e6:17

value
706058
script pubkey
OP_0 OP_PUSHBYTES_20 52093b0c111e4a808b07d5485994680b0c4c3121
address
bc1q2gynkrq3re9gpzc864y9n9rgpvxycvfpseqdze
transaction
f374a13308199879240b1052c536e6bfa746de34d2c55d0a8dd06064067f00e6
confirmations
127778
spent
true